# Basement Archive Room — Night Access

The archive room under Pellworth House holds old contracts and the tape backups. Night shift: take stairwell C, not the lift (it's switched off after midnight). Lights are on a timer by the door — slap the button as you go in. Sign the logbook, even at 3am, yes really. The keypad by the door takes the code below.

staff pass of fahap-tajeg = bdg-FT-6

Q: Why does the Tindrel doc linter reject my plugin README? A: It enforces the Harkwell style rules: one H1, alphabetized anchors, no bare tables. Run it locally with the `--plugin` profile before submitting. Failures block publishing. To unlock the linter's private rule bundle, use the recovery passphrase below.

strongbox words: istwyn-normir-silwyn-ulaius-istwyn

## Deep-Link Routing 101

Welcome aboard! The Larkspur app routes deep links through RouteNest, our little in-house resolver. Every link hits the manifest first, then falls back to the web view if no screen matches. Most bugs come from stale manifests, so always check the version header. The full routing map and edge cases live on our internal page.

wiki page, yagef-fahaf: https://grafana.ferracorp.corp/spaces/view/projects/board/job/board/issue/dddcb27874b55298d2204852

#### Runbook: Timezone handling in Quillport report exports

All export timestamps are normalized to UTC before serialization; your plugin must not re-apply the workspace offset, or reports will shift by hours near DST boundaries. Verify against the reference fixtures before publishing. Confirm your plugin was validated against the export build identified by the token below.

pipeline stamp: htk31_f769b577b3028a4e9958e5bb8d1259a